titleOfInvention | Method and device for recovering connection failure to network in next generation mobile communication system |
abstract | The disclosure relates to a communication method and system for converging a 5th-Generation (5G) communication system for supporting higher data rates beyond a 4th-Generation (4G) system with a technology for Internet of Things (IoT). The disclosure may be applied to intelligent services based on the 5G communication technology and the IoT-related technology, such as smart home, smart building, smart city, smart car, connected car, health care, digital education, smart retail, security and safety services. The disclosure relates to a method and a device for quickly recovering a connection to a network in a next-generation mobile communication system when the connection to the network fails. |
